Iron County, Wisconsin
Housing Units,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 5,721
People
Population
Population estimates, July 1, 2025, (V2025) 6,127
Population estimates, July 1, 2024, (V2024) 6,235
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2025) 6,137
Population estimates base, April 1, 2020, (V2024) 6,131
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2025, (V2025) -0.2%
Population, percent change - April 1, 2020 (estimates base) to July 1, 2024, (V2024) 1.7%
Population, Census, April 1, 2020 6,137
Population, Census, April 1, 2010 5,916
Age and Sex
Persons under 5 years, percent 3.8%
Persons under 18 years, percent 15.9%
Persons 65 years and over, percent 34.5%
Female persons, percent 49.7%
